3-Pentanol, 1,5-bis (tetrahydro-2-furyl)-

Names

[ CAS No. ]:
6265-26-5

[ Name ]:
3-Pentanol, 1,5-bis (tetrahydro-2-furyl)-

[Synonym ]:
1,5-Bis(tetrahydro-2-furyl)-3-pentanol
1,5-di(2-tetrahydrofuryl)-3-pentanol
1,5-Bis(2-tetrahydrofuryl)-3-pentanol
3-Pentanol,1,5-bis(tetrahydro-2-furyl)
1,5-ditetrahydrofuryl-3-pentanol
1,5-bis-tetrahydro[2]furyl-pentan-3-ol
1,5-ditetrahydrofurylpentan-3-ol

Chemical & Physical Properties

[ Density]:
1.035g/cm3

[ Boiling Point ]:
351.6ºC at 760 mmHg

[ Molecular Formula ]:
C13H24O3

[ Molecular Weight ]:
228.32800

[ Flash Point ]:
174.5ºC

[ Exact Mass ]:
228.17300

[ PSA ]:
38.69000

[ LogP ]:
2.26570

[ Index of Refraction ]:
1.481

Toxicological Information

CHEMICAL IDENTIFICATION

RTECS NUMBER :
SA5775000
CHEMICAL NAME :
3-Pentanol, 1,5-bis(tetrahydro-2-furyl)-
CAS REGISTRY NUMBER :
6265-26-5
BEILSTEIN REFERENCE NO. :
0117477
LAST UPDATED :
199612
DATA ITEMS CITED :
2
MOLECULAR FORMULA :
C13-H24-O3
MOLECULAR WEIGHT :
228.37
WISWESSER LINE NOTATION :
T5OTJ B2YQ2- BT5OTJ

HEALTH HAZARD DATA

ACUTE TOXICITY DATA

TYPE OF TEST :
LDLo - Lowest published lethal dose
ROUTE OF EXPOSURE :
Intraperitoneal
SPECIES OBSERVED :
Rodent - mouse
DOSE/DURATION :
500 mg/kg
TOXIC EFFECTS :
Behavioral - altered sleep time (including change in righting reflex) Lungs, Thorax, or Respiration - dyspnea
REFERENCE :
CBCCT* "Summary Tables of Biological Tests," National Research Council Chemical-Biological Coordination Center. (National Academy of Science Library, 2101 Constitution Ave., NW, Washington, DC 20418) Volume(issue)/page/year: 6,224,1954
TYPE OF TEST :
LDLo - Lowest published lethal dose
ROUTE OF EXPOSURE :
Parenteral
SPECIES OBSERVED :
Rodent - mouse
DOSE/DURATION :
1200 mg/kg
TOXIC EFFECTS :
Details of toxic effects not reported other than lethal dose value
REFERENCE :
CBCCT* "Summary Tables of Biological Tests," National Research Council Chemical-Biological Coordination Center. (National Academy of Science Library, 2101 Constitution Ave., NW, Washington, DC 20418) Volume(issue)/page/year: 7,692,1955
